Abstract

The utility model discloses an air conditioner shell structure, which comprises a first shell, a second shell, an upper cover body and a lower cover body, wherein the first shell and the second shell are mutually buckled and fixed through a first buckle structure; the upper cover body is fixed on the upper portions of the first shell and the second shell through a second buckle structure, and the lower cover body is arranged on the lower portions of the first shell and the second shell. According to the utility model, the first shell and the second shell are mutually buckled and fixed through the first buckle structure, the upper cover body is fixed on the upper parts of the first shell and the second shell through the second buckle structure, screws are not used for fixing on the basic assembly of the shells, the production cost of the shell structures is favorably reduced, the assembly efficiency is improved, and the mounting and fixing structures among the shells can be skillfully shielded and hidden after the shells are assembled.

Background
Along with the development of society and the improvement of living standard of people, various household electrical appliances are increasingly popularized, the types of the electrical appliances are more and more, and the functions are different. In order to ensure the comfort of the home environment of people, people can use some devices to keep the temperature, the humidity, the freshness and the like of indoor air, wherein the air conditioner is the most common electrical equipment in the functional electrical appliances and is almost spread in various scenes of life of people. In recent years, with the advent of mobile air conditioners (small portable air conditioners), it has become more convenient for people to use air conditioners without space restrictions. The traditional air conditioner shell adopts screws too much to realize mutual fixation, so that on one hand, the assembly efficiency is low, the labor and material costs are high, on the other hand, the attractiveness of the air conditioner is influenced by the screws too much exposed, and particularly, the screw is more obvious under the condition that the screws of metal parts are rusted.

An air conditioner casing structure as shown in fig. 1-4 comprises a first casing 1, a second casing 2, an upper cover 3 and a lower cover 4, wherein the first casing 1 and the second casing 2 are fastened and fixed with each other through a first fastening structure, the first fastening structure comprises a plurality of hooks 101 arranged on the edge side of the first casing 1 and a plurality of bayonets arranged on the edge of the second casing 2, and the hooks 101 are arranged corresponding to the bayonets; the upper cover body 3 is fixed on the upper parts of the first shell 1 and the second shell 2 through a second buckle structure, and the lower cover body 4 is arranged on the lower parts of the first shell 1 and the second shell 2; the second snap structure comprises a snap hole portion 201 arranged on the second housing 2 and a snap post arranged on the upper cover 3, wherein a step 301 is formed at the edge of the upper cover 3, and flanges are formed inwards at the upper side edges of the first housing 1 and the second housing 2. When the housing is assembled, after the first housing 1 and the second housing 2 are fastened and fixed with each other, the fastening hole portion 201 on the second housing 2 is fastened on the fastening column of the upper cover 3 at the same time, so as to lock the upper cover 3 in the horizontal direction; meanwhile, the buckling hole part 201 is abutted to the lower side of the upper cover body 3, the convex edges of the first shell body 1 and the second shell body 2 are abutted to the upper side of the edge step 301 of the upper cover body 3, so that the upper cover body 3 is locked in the vertical direction, and the basic assembly of the shell body is free of screw fixation, so that the assembly efficiency can be improved, and the use of hardware is reduced, so that the production cost of the shell structure is reduced.
As a housing structure of an air conditioner, the first housing 1 and the second housing 2 are assembled to form an air inlet, which is shown in the attached drawings, and two air inlets are provided in the embodiment, which are arranged on two opposite sides of the housing structure and are respectively formed by enclosing the first housing 1 and the second housing 2, i.e. the air inlet includes a portion arranged on the first housing 1 and a portion arranged on the second housing 2.
In practical application, in order to ensure the safe operation of the air conditioner, a protective net is arranged on the air inlet, the protective net comprises a first protective net 5, a first mounting screw hole 501 is arranged on the upper side of the first protective net 5, and the first protective net 5 and the upper cover body 3 can be fastened and connected through screws. First protection network 5 left and right sides is equipped with a plurality of posts 502 of inserting respectively, the position of inserting the post is then corresponded the position of inserting the post and the edge side of second casing 2 and set up a plurality of sockets respectively to the edge side correspondence of first casing 1, insert corresponding socket through inserting post 502 during the equipment so that first protection network 5 fixes on air conditioner shell structure's air intake, because installation screw and socket all are located the casing inboard after the equipment, thereby hide the mounting structure of first protection network 5, reach pleasing to the eye effect. In this embodiment, the first casing 1, the upper cover 3 and the first protective net 5 may be fixed to each other first and then fixed to the second casing 2 in an inserting manner during assembly, so that the assembly operation is relatively simple, and the assembly efficiency can be further improved.
Referring to the drawings, the first protective net 5 of the present embodiment is further provided with a plurality of second mounting screw holes 503, and the second mounting screw holes 503 can be used for mounting and fixing components inside the air conditioner. In this embodiment, the second protection net 6 is disposed outside the first protection net 5, the first protection net 5 and the second protection net 6 are fastened and fixed to each other through a third fastening structure, specifically, the third fastening structure includes a protection net fastening hole 504 disposed on the first protection net 5 and a protection net fastening hook disposed on the second protection net 6, after the first casing 1, the second casing 2 and the first protection net 5 are assembled and fixed to each other, the second protection net 6 can be fastened and fixed to the first protection net 5, and a shielding cover for the second installation screw 503 is formed, so as to form a hidden installation and fixation structure, thereby preventing the screw from being exposed, optimizing the appearance structure of the air conditioner casing, and also forming an effective protection for the metal screw, thereby preventing the metal screw from being corroded and rusted.
The mobile air conditioner provided by the utility model has the air conditioner shell structure, has the characteristics of few metal parts, low cost, convenience in assembly, high assembly efficiency and the like, and the installation and fixing structures among the shells can be skillfully shielded and hidden after the shells are assembled, so that a more concise and attractive appearance structure is formed.
